Executive Compensation Analysis
The organization consistently reports 0% officer compensation across all available filings, suggesting that executive salaries are either not paid directly by this specific entity or are covered by a parent organization, which is a common structure within large healthcare systems like UPMC. This practice, while not inherently negative, can obscure the full picture of executive remuneration within the broader system.

Red Flags
The following concerns were identified during AI analysis of Upmc Conemaugh Cancer Center's IRS 990 filings:
- Significant and consistent decline in total assets over the past eight years, from $5,205,558 in 2015 to $641,998 in 2023.
- Substantial decrease in annual revenue from $6,165,696 in 2016 to $3,404,962 in 2023, indicating a shrinking operational scale.
- Consistent 'break-even' financial reporting where revenue equals expenses, which, while not a deficit, could mask underlying financial shifts or a lack of surplus for future investment.

Filing History
IRS 990 filing history for Upmc Conemaugh Cancer Center showing financial trends over 13 years of public records:
Over 13 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2023), Upmc Conemaugh Cancer Center's revenue has declined by 38.8%, moving from $5.6M to $3.4M. Total assets decreased by 81.4% over the same period, from $3.4M to $642K. Total functional expenses fell by 38.8%, from $5.6M to $3.4M. In its most recent filing year (2023), Upmc Conemaugh Cancer Center reported a surplus of $0, with revenue exceeding expenses. The organization holds $215K in liabilities against $642K in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 33.6%), resulting in net assets of $427K.
